Position Title: Design/Manufacturing Engineer (2026 Summer Internship)
Reports to: Engineering Manager
Job Location: Onsite in Norwich, KS
Employment Type: Hourly
Hours: 40 hours per week
Compensation: $18/hour
Application Deadline: 2/20/2026
Position Summary
Summer internships are 40 hours per week, typically lasting from late May to early August. Interns will work in person at our Norwich, KS facility. This position will work within our pattern shop, foundry, and machine shop learning and assisting in all engineering and production support tasks.
Primary Responsibilities
+ Assist in developing manufacturing processes for new products
+ Design and produce foundry tooling and finishing work holding components
+ Program/Setup CNC machining equipment (lathes, 3 & 4 axis mills, 5 axis mill-turns)
+ Work closely with engineering and production personnel to investigate and solve technical problems
+ Assist with and lead process improvements for production teams
+ Develop setup and work instructions
+ Research and implement new tools and manufacturing processes
Education/Experience:
Pursuing a Bachelor of Science degree in one of the following:
+ Manufacturing Engineer
+ Mechanical Engineering
+ Manufacturing Engineering Technology
+ Robotics/Mechatronics Engineering
+ Industrial Engineering
+ Engineering Technology
+ Other related fields
Qualifications
+ Applicants must be authorized to work lawfully in the U.S. at the time of making application, and visa sponsorship is not available for this position, including for F-1 students and J-1 exchange visitors who will need employment sponsorship
+ Candidates must be able to work onsite for the entirety of the internship program unless otherwise approved by the supervisor
+ A basic knowledge of manufacturing, industrial, or mechanical engineering principles
+ 3D CAD education or experience (SolidWorks preferred)
+ Experience with Mastercam
+ Understanding of CNC machining and programming
+ Strong work ethic, communication, problem solving, and organizational skills
Work Environment / Safety Requirements
+ Must adhere to all safety rules and wear required PPE
+ Work may involve exposure to noise and dust in a non-climate controlled environment.
